A time-domain analysis of robust string stability is carried out for finite length vehicular platoons, where disturbances and constant delays in the inter-vehicle communication are present. The goal of the paper is to compare and evaluate the accuracy and computational cost of several Lyapunov-Krasovskii functional (LKF)-based methods. The proposed approach can be extended to cope with time-varying delays, large scale systems, vehicle model uncertainties and platoon heterogeneity. Simple delay-independent, delay-dependent and discretized complete LKF-based performance criteria are presented and demonstrated on a platoon with predecessor and leader following control architecture.
